MIAMI-DADE COUNTY, Fla. — Travelers faced significant frustration at Miami International Airport on Monday, following a deadly cargo plane crash that occurred the day before. The incident disrupted the busy Labor Day travel weekend, leading to numerous delays and cancellations.
One traveler shared her challenging journey: “I started out in Buffalo, New York, went to Raleigh, then had a seven-hour layover, followed by another hour layover in Denver before finally arriving here.” Another flyer mentioned that her flight had been rescheduled three times.
The crash led to an immediate ground stop at the airport, particularly affecting inbound flights. Reports indicated nearly 150 delays and 60 cancellations by mid-morning on Monday. Some passengers reported spending over ten hours at the airport, waiting for updates, only to have their flights canceled without warning.
These delays also impacted flight crews trying to reach Miami, further complicating the situation at the airport.
